The Intel Xeon Platinum 8450H is a Sapphire Rapids processor positioned for data centers that need a scalable balance of core density, memory bandwidth and I/O capability in multi-socket configurations. It is designed for large virtualized clusters, analytics platforms and enterprise workloads that must run predictably under sustained high utilization across several sockets and heterogeneous software stacks.
With 28 cores and 56 threads, the 8450H sits between high-frequency low-core SKUs and extreme-density models, which makes it attractive for environments where both concurrency and per-core responsiveness matter. A 2.0 GHz base frequency combined with a 3.5 GHz turbo ceiling gives it enough headroom to handle latency-sensitive control-plane components, transactional services and mixed microservice deployments, while still providing sufficient parallelism for batch processing, reporting and background jobs running on the same nodes.
Sapphire Rapids brings architectural improvements across the entire core pipeline: more efficient branch prediction, updated execution units, smarter prefetching and better memory disambiguation. In practice this reduces pipeline stalls and improves instructions-per-cycle versus older Xeon generations. For real-world deployments, this is visible in smoother behaviour of JVM- and .NET-based applications, lower jitter under virtualization and more predictable performance curves when nodes are heavily overcommitted with containers or virtual machines.
A key pillar of the 8450H’s design is its DDR5 memory subsystem. The processor supports eight memory channels with effective speeds up to 4400–4800 MT/s, which significantly increases available bandwidth compared to DDR4 platforms. This matters for workloads that operate on large in-memory datasets, such as distributed SQL engines, data warehouses, stream-processing frameworks, search clusters and telemetry analytics. Higher memory bandwidth and improved bank parallelism help reduce tail latency in queries and stabilize throughput when many tenants or services are hitting the same shared infrastructure.
The cache hierarchy is tuned for mixed enterprise workloads. Each core is backed by 2 MB of L2 cache, and the processor exposes 75 MB of shared L3. This structure supports heavy metadata access, frequent context switching and a wide variety of instruction footprints, which are typical in multi-tenant environments running orchestration layers, message queues, CI/CD tooling, monitoring stacks and application backends on the same hardware. The larger L3 helps maintain locality when many threads from different services are active simultaneously.
On the I/O side, the Xeon Platinum 8450H offers 80 lanes of PCI Express 5.0, giving system architects enough bandwidth to combine dense NVMe storage, high-speed networking (including 100G and 200G adapters), SmartNICs, DPUs and accelerator cards for AI inference or compression. PCIe 5.0 bandwidth ensures that storage fabrics and network traffic do not become bottlenecks once CPU and memory have been upgraded, which is crucial for hyperconverged infrastructures and software-defined storage systems.
The 250 W TDP indicates a throughput-oriented design that assumes robust server cooling, typically in 2U or 4U platforms. Importantly, Sapphire Rapids improves turbo stability under sustained load compared to earlier Xeon Scalable generations. For operators of Kubernetes clusters, virtualized private clouds or large ERP/CRM backends, this translates into more consistent performance and fewer surprises in p95/p99 latencies when the platform is heavily loaded.
Another strategic characteristic of the 8450H is its support for multi-socket topologies up to 8 processors on a motherboard. This allows building high-core-count servers with substantial memory footprints and I/O capacity without moving to more exotic platforms. Such systems are often used in large in-memory databases, big SAP and Oracle installations, risk modelling in finance and large simulation workloads where consolidation onto fewer but more capable nodes simplifies management and licensing.
In comparison with lower-tier Xeon Gold models, the Xeon Platinum 8450H is intended for roles where core consolidation, memory bandwidth scaling and multi-socket performance are central requirements. It offers a substantial upgrade path for organisations moving from Cascade Lake or Ice Lake, delivering higher throughput, improved virtualization behaviour and expanded I/O headroom through PCIe 5.0. As a platform foundation for dense virtualization, analytics clusters and enterprise application servers, it blends strong compute capacity with long-term infrastructure scalability.
